How much do service man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 24, 2026, the average yearly pay for service manager in Bloomfield, NM is $61,035.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$45,400.00 and $70,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a service manager?

Service manager is a broad title given to positions throughout a wide variety of industries. As it is an umbrella term, responsibilities vary significantly from job to job. However, in all service manager positions, your duties revolve around ensuring that the services your company offers are running smoothly. This means coordinating with a team of service workers to ensure that their work meets the standards set by the company and the industry. In industries like healthcare, this may require more than basic customer service, as your team must also meet government regulations. Management positions may require overtime, especially in shift work industries, as you are responsible for the performance of the entire department, not just a particular shift. Necessary skills and qualifications vary by job. However, all service managers must be organized, able to delegate when needed, and have excellent communication skills.

What does a service manager do?

A Service Manager oversees the delivery of customer service within an organization, ensuring that client needs are met efficiently and effectively. They manage service teams, coordinate maintenance or repair schedules, handle customer inquiries or complaints, and work to improve overall service quality. Service Managers also analyze service processes, implement improvements, and ensure compliance with company policies and standards. Their goal is to enhance customer satisfaction and support the business’s operational goals.

What is the difference between Service Manager vs Customer Service Supervisor?

AspectService ManagerCustomer Service Supervisor
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in business, management, or related field; certifications like Certified Service Manager (CSM) are commonOften requires a high school diploma or associate degree; some roles prefer customer service certifications
Work EnvironmentOversees service departments, manages teams, and interacts with clients in service centers or corporate officesSupervises customer service representatives, handles escalations, and ensures customer satisfaction in call centers or retail settings
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across industries like automotive, IT, hospitality, and facilities managementCommon in retail, telecommunications, and hospitality sectors

The Service Manager focuses on managing entire service operations, team leadership, and strategic planning, while the Customer Service Supervisor primarily oversees customer interactions and team performance. Both roles require strong communication skills, but the Service Manager typically has broader responsibilities and higher qualifications.

Job description


Efficiently deploys and manages equipment, materials, and personnel to job sites with a focus of optimizing costs and maximizing manpower utilization. Implements company maintenance standards. Creates customer satisfaction by providing technical and operational expertise and service excellence. Creates employee satisfaction by ensuring that employees are set up for success and ensures employee engagement and retention. Spends the majority of time in the field performing PM audits, unit inspections, guiding, mentoring, monitoring performance, and attending customer meetings. On a very limited basis, spends time doing the work of the FST.
Responsibilities
Essential Duties: (Approximate % of Time Spent)
- Effectively coordinates the deployment of equipment, materials and personnel to job sites at optimum utilization and minimum cost across one or more service delivery processes such as basic preventative maintenance or call out / repair. (~20%)
- Ensures that Service Requests (SR's) are initiated, managed and processed in a timely manner. Manages labor to deliver company maintenance standard. (~30%)
- Compiles and conveys job-specific information to Field Service Technicians, other Service Managers and/or Senior Manager(s). Coordinates work with other Service Managers/Coordinators to minimize equipment downtime and most effectively utilize personnel. (~10%)
- Evaluates safety, quality, schedule and budget performance versus benchmarks. Participates in weekly management reviews of operational measures and corrective actions, evaluates against benchmarks, and develops, communicates and executes action plans for improvement. (~10%)
- Serves as the primary customer contact for the service area and provides technical/operational expertise in response to customer inquiries. Makes pre- and post-job callbacks to customers. (~10%)
- Participates in the purchase of parts/ core return, tools, capex submittals, and vehicle requests per the delegation of authority. (~10%)
- Manages annual budget and implements operational standards and processes. (~10%)
Non-Essential Duties: Performs other duties as assigned.

About Us
Archrock is a premier provider of natural gas compression services to customers in the energy industry throughout the U.S. and a leading supplier of aftermarket services to customers who own compression equipment. With approximately 1,000 employees, our unmatched expertise and team of highly qualified, certified technicians are backed by more than 70 years of industry experience.
